Corrosion is a persistent issue that impacts various industries and infrastructure. Traditional solutions often rely on corrosive chemicals, posing significant environmental risks. However, the concept of "Go Green" presents a compelling alternative to address corrosion while eliminating environmental impact. By adopting eco-friendly materials and practices, we can effectively combat corrosion and simultaneously preserving our ecosystem.
Some examples of green strategies include:
*
Utilizing biodegradable coatings
* Implementing wear resistant composites made from renewable resources.
* Employing innovative technologies like nanotechnology to minimize corrosion.
These sustainable solutions not only reduce environmental impact but also improve the durability of infrastructure, causing long-term financial advantages.

Corrosion's Silent Threat: Protecting Our Infrastructure
Infrastructure, the backbone of our modern world, faces a constant threat: corrosion. This insidious process slowly weakenes vital components like bridges, pipelines, and power lines, posing a critical risk to safety, industry, and stability. To mitigate this persistent danger, it's imperative to implement stringent maintenance strategies.
- Diligent monitoring
- Corrosion-resistant materials
- Early detection and repair
By embracing these measures, we can safeguard our foundations from the costly effects of corrosion and ensure a more reliable future.

Protecting metallic structures from the ravages of corrosion is crucial for maintaining infrastructure integrity and longevity. Traditional methods often rely on corrosive chemicals, posing risks to both human health and the environment. Thankfully, a growing array of green alternatives are emerging, offering effective corrosion control while minimizing ecological impact.
These solutions encompass a wide range: from utilizing organic coatings to implementing protective oil penetrating spray systems that leverage renewable energy sources. Furthermore, scientists are exploring the potential of nanomaterials and self-healing coatings to create next-generation corrosion prevention. By embracing these greener options, we can safeguard our infrastructure while protecting the planet for future generations.
